With heavy hearts and tearful eyes, we announce the peaceful passing of Karen A. Walters-Keen, aged 74, of Navarre. Surrounded by her devoted family, Karen transitioned from this life after a sudden decline in health on Saturday, January 27, 2024. As we bid farewell to a cherished mother, wife, and friend, we gather to honor the legacy of a woman whose presence illuminated the lives of all who knew her.

A Life’s Journey Begins: May 17, 1949

Karen’s journey began on May 17, 1949, in the vibrant city of Canton, Ohio. Born to the late Wilbur and Marie (Schmidt) Simonson, Karen entered the world with a spirit of resilience and an innate kindness that would define her existence. From her earliest days, she exuded a warmth and compassion that endeared her to those around her.

Joined in Love: April 24, 1971

On April 24, 1971, Karen embarked on a journey of love and partnership as she exchanged vows with John Walters. Their union was a testament to the enduring power of love, and together, they forged a bond that would withstand the tests of time. Though John departed this world on a July day, Karen’s love for him endured, a testament to the depth of her devotion.
